One of the most significant advancements in this transformation is the development of the Pouch Filling and Packing Machine. This sophisticated equipment is designed to automate the entire process of filling and sealing pouches, which has traditionally been a labor-intensive task. By integrating automation into pouch packaging, companies can achieve greater precision, speed, and consistency in their operations.

At the heart of this transformation is speed. In today’s fast-paced market, the ability to package products quickly without compromising quality is crucial. Automated pouch filling and packing machines can operate at a rate that far exceeds manual packing. Depending on the model, these machines can fill and seal hundreds of pouches per minute, significantly reducing the time required to bring products to market. This speed not only enhances productivity but also allows companies to respond quickly to consumer demands and market changes, giving them a competitive edge.

Moreover, the consistency offered by these machines is unparalleled. In manual processes, human error can lead to discrepancies in fill levels, sealing issues, and package integrity. An automated Pouch Filling and Packing Machine ensures that every pouch is filled to the exact specifications, maintaining quality and reducing waste. This consistency is particularly important in industries like food and pharmaceuticals, where precision can directly impact safety and compliance with regulatory standards.

Automation also plays a critical role in workforce optimization. By automating repetitive and mundane tasks, companies can free their human resources to focus on more strategic initiatives. This shift leads to a more engaged workforce, where workers are involved in higher-level decision-making and quality assurance rather than tedious manual labor. As a result, organizations can foster a culture of innovation and continuous improvement, greatly enhancing their overall operational efficiency.

Another vital aspect of automation in pouch packaging is sustainability. As consumers become more environmentally conscious, there is a growing demand for sustainable packaging solutions. Automated systems can optimize material usage, minimize waste, and utilize recyclable or biodegradable materials more effectively. For instance, advanced sensors can detect the exact amount of product needed for each pouch, eliminating overfilling and reducing the amount of packaging material utilized. Furthermore, automation can streamline the recycling process, which is increasingly being demanded by consumers and regulatory bodies alike.

While the benefits of automation are clear, integrating such technology into existing systems can be daunting. Companies need to carefully assess their workflows, machinery, and intended products before investing in automated pouch filling and packing machines. This requires not only a financial investment but also a commitment to ongoing training and adaptation to new technologies. Embracing this change is crucial, as those who hesitate may find themselves outpaced by competitors who have successfully integrated automated solutions.

Investment in automation also opens up opportunities for customizability and flexibility in packaging. The latest Pouch Filling and Packing Machines are designed to handle various pouch sizes, shapes, and materials, allowing businesses to adapt quickly to changing market needs. This flexibility can be particularly beneficial for businesses that operate in sectors requiring a diverse product range, enabling them to switch effortlessly between different packaging options without extensive reconfiguration.

As automation continues to permeate pouch packaging, the importance of data analytics cannot be overstated. With automation, businesses can collect valuable data on the packaging process, tracing everything from production speed to material waste. Analyzing this data enables companies to identify inefficiencies, predict maintenance needs, and optimize their operations continually. This capability transforms packaging from a straightforward task into a data-driven process that feeds directly into overall business strategy.
